The online description of this top boasts: A cami this irresistible could only be Skims.

Well, we hate to break it to you Kim Kardashian, but it could also be Primark.

The high street giant’s more purse-friendly co-ord set in the same love heart print is a fraction of the price, at just £7 for the pair.

Skims’ set is made from polyamide and elastane, while Primark’s is made from nylon and elastane – which means they are made from the same fabric, but with one brand you’re paying for the Kardashian connection.

Channel your inner A-lister with a leopard print bra and brief set to rival lingerie by iconic Italian fashion brand Dolce & Gabbana.

Not only do you get three pairs of sexy, high-waisted knickers that will enhance your curves, you also get to choose from a wider variety of sizes.

Available in size 8-28 in the briefs and 30A-40 in the bra, M&S’s nod to D&G’s fierce print is clearly the savvy way to go.

As well as looking phenomenal in your statement underwear, you’ll be comfy, too. M&S’s bra is non-wired, while still bringing the bust support you need. And who doesn’t love a big, comfy pair of pants?
